General Information of Fireclay brick UNF46
Our corporation produces a comprehensive range of Fireclay bricks, with 30% to 55% alumina content, all of these bricks exhibit excellent performance.
Our Fireclay bricks are the final result of blending excellent fused alumina and silicon as the main raw materials with cutting-edge technology, adding superfine powder, after mixing, drying, forming, in the high temperature shuttle kiln. We ensure you that the Fireclay Bricks made by us possess high quality standard and have gone through all the complicated quality control parameters. Their durability and strength adds life to the structure and they have the capacity of bearing high temperature.

Feature of Fireclay Brick UNF46
Resistant to thermal shock, abrasion, chemical attack
High ability for anti-abrasion during work
Low shrinkage degree under high temperature so as to maintaining integrity of the furnace lining
Low apparent porosity, and low Fe2O3 content to reduce the carbon deposit in the blowhole and avoid the bricks broken in case of expansion
Applications of Fireclay Brick UNF46
Fireclay brick UNF46 is mainly used in the part of throat, stack, hearth, bottom for blast furnace and the stack for a big blast furnace.
1. Carbon baked furnaces in the alumina industry
2. Preheat zones and cyclones of rotary cement kilns
3. Insulation for glass tanks
4. Coke ovens
5. Blast furnaces
6. Reheating furnaces
7. Suspended roofs
8. Lime kilns
9. Chimney

- Q:What are the advantages and disadvantages of clay refractory bricks?
- The mineral composition of clay brick is mainly kaolinite (Al2O3, 2SiO2, 2H2O) and 6%~7% impurities (potassium, sodium, calcium, titanium, iron oxides). The sintering process of clay brick is mainly the process of the continuous dehydration of kaolinite and the formation of crystallization of mullite (3Al2O3. 2SiO2). SiO2 and Al2O3 in clay bricks form eutectic, low melting point silicates with impurities during sintering, and are surrounded by mullite crystals.

- Q:What is the size of mechanism brick and general refractory brick?
- The ordinary refractory brick is 230mm long, 53mm thick; red brick is 240mm long, 115mm wide, 65mm thick,
